Intern, Market Analyst (Automotive)- EN

CN is a premium railroad committed to safety and service, and they are seeking an Intern, Market Analyst to support their Automotive team. The role involves analyzing data, enhancing processes, and creating dashboards using Power BI to improve overall efficiency within the organization.

Responsibilities

Develop a Power BI solution that consolidates rail data with all non-line haul components, including associated costs, rates, and industry forecasts, into a single, centralized dashboard
Help organize and refine processes for better clarity and efficiency
Analyze data to identify trends and insights that can drive decision-making
Assist in transforming important contract details into digital formats for easier access and management
Support the enhancement of dashboards to improve data visualization and reporting
